Heat Sealing is the process of sealing one thermoplastic material with another using pressure and heat together. The method of sealing utilizes a constantly heated sealing bar or die to apply heat to a specific contact path or area to weld the thermoplastic together. The temperature of the machine is adjustable. It is a fully pneumatic model that has a digital display and based on microprocessors.

The heat sealer Prima is equipped with two jaws i.e. lower jaw and upper jaw. Both the jaws of the machine can be heated separately with different temperatures and controllers. Hence, it is possible to maintain the temperature of both the jaws separately. It is possible to enable or heat one heater at a time, and it is also possible to switch off one heater in between while performing the test.
